A micro PC, also known as a mini PC or small form factor (SFF) computer, is a compact computing device that offers the full functionality of a traditional desktop in a significantly smaller footprint. These systems are designed for space-constrained environments where reliability, low power consumption, and silent operation are critical. They typically feature fanless, passively cooled designs, making them ideal for industrial settings with dust or vibration.
Key Specifications and Technical Details
Modern industrial micro PCs are built around efficient, low-power processors from Intel's N-series or Celeron series. Key specifications include:
-
Form Factor: Ultra-compact designs, often measuring just a few inches in each dimension.
-
Cooling: Fanless, sealed chassis for silent operation and protection against dust.
-
Processors: Energy-efficient Intel processors (e.g., N100, N95, J4125) with 4 or more cores.
-
Memory & Storage: Configurations typically range from 4GB to 16GB of RAM and 128GB to 512GB of SSD storage.
-
Connectivity: Multiple USB ports (including USB 3.2), HDMI outputs, and Gigabit Ethernet for network reliability.
-
Power: Low-voltage DC input (e.g., 12V), reducing energy costs and heat generation.
Use Cases and Applications
The compact and robust nature of micro PCs makes them perfect for embedded and edge computing applications:
-
Digital Signage & Kiosks: Powering interactive displays in retail, hospitality, and public spaces.
-
Industrial Automation: Acting as a controller for PLCs, HMIs, and machine vision systems on the factory floor.
-
Thin Client & VDI: Providing a secure endpoint for virtual desktop infrastructure in offices and call centers.
-
IoT Gateways: Collecting and processing data from sensors in smart city, agricultural, or logistics networks.
-
In-Vehicle Computing: Used in fleet management, public transportation, and mobile retail due to their vibration resistance.
Comparison of Common Micro PC Processors
| Processor Model | Cores/Threads | Max Frequency | Typical Use Case |
|---|---|---|---|
| Intel N100 | 4 Cores / 4 Threads | Up to 3.4 GHz | General-purpose industrial computing, digital signage, basic VDI. |
| Intel N95 | 4 Cores / 4 Threads | Up to 3.4 GHz | Entry-level kiosks, lightweight edge computing nodes. |
| Intel J4125 | 4 Cores / 4 Threads | Up to 2.7 GHz | Legacy-compatible systems, low-power embedded applications. |
